A single cell might hold a several thousand up to a few million ribosomes. [17], In eukaryotes, the small subunit protein RPS27A (or eS31) and the large subunit protein RPL40 (or eL40) are processed polypeptides, which are translated as fusion proteins carrying N-terminal ubiquitin domains. The larger subunit of ribosome contains an important enzyme peptidyl transferase, which brings about the formation of peptide bond. [28] Elucidation of the interactions between the eukaryotic ribosome and initiation factors at an atomic level is essential for a mechanistic understanding of the regulatory processes, but represents a significant technical challenge, because of the inherent dynamics and flexibility of the initiation complexes. In eukaryotes, ribosomes form in the nucleolus, a structure inside the cells nucleus. Since prokaryotes do not have a membrane-bound nucleus, ribosomes form within the cytoplasm.
